Dr Ayda Khandani is an experienced General Practitioner with more than 13 years of
clinical experience, including extensive experience in regional Australia. She has
worked in Western Australia in both general practice and an Aboriginal Health Centre,
gaining valuable experience in regional and culturally diverse healthcare settings and
developing a strong understanding of culturally sensitive, patient-centered care.
Prior to and alongside her career in general practice, Dr Khandani has extensive
experience in Obstetrics and Gynaecology, bringing a strong background in women’s
health to her GP practice. She has worked in Australia across Western Australia and
Wodonga, caring for patients across a broad range of clinical presentations and
healthcare needs.
Her clinical interests include women’s health, gynaecology and obstetrics, paediatrics,
chronic disease management, minor skin procedures, Implanon insertion and removal,
and IUD insertion and removal.
